Job Summary

We are seeking a highly skilled Medical Laboratory Technician to join our team at Fresenius Medical Care North America. As a Medical Laboratory Technician, you will play a critical role in ensuring the accuracy and reliability of laboratory testing results.

Key Responsibilities
  • Perform pre-analytical, analytical, and post-analytical phases of laboratory testing using manual procedures and operating various laboratory equipment and automated analyzer systems.
  • Acquire job skills and adhere to department procedures.
  • Review and comply with the Code of Business Conduct and all applicable company policies and procedures, local, state, and federal laws and regulations.
  • Work on assignments requiring considerable judgment and initiative.
  • May refer to Senior Staff with day-to-day problems that may arise.
  • Under general supervision by a Technical Supervisor or Lead, prepare and perform testing, editing, and reporting of various clinical tests as directed under department SOPs and applicable state and private regulatory agencies.
  • May perform principal duties and responsibilities of all levels of Laboratory Assistants.
  • Responsible for daily equipment maintenance and troubleshooting under general supervision.
  • If applicable by local governing state requirements, perform routine laboratory protocols; pipetting, measuring, and pouring of samples.
  • Follows the laboratory's established policies and procedures whenever test systems are not within the laboratory's established acceptable levels of performance.
  • Documents daily, weekly, and monthly quality control and maintenance procedures as assigned. Document all corrective actions taken when test systems deviate from the laboratory's established performance specifications.
  • Fully understands policies and procedures prior to performing proficiency testing.
  • Performs specimen handling for inter-laboratory tests.
  • Provides mentorship and training of Lab Assistants.
  • Performs routine monitoring of reagents, chemicals, equipment parts, and other necessary supplies for testing.
  • Complies with all laboratory safety protocols, including, but not limited to, the use of personal protective equipment (PPE), proper laboratory techniques, disposal of biohazard, etc.
  • May escalate difficult/complex issues to supervisor for resolution, as deemed necessary.
  • Assists with various projects as assigned.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ned
Requirements
  • Associates of Science Degree in Medical Laboratory Technology required or Bachelor's Degree in Applied, Biological, or Laboratory Sciences with MLT certification strongly preferred.
  • If applicable by local governing state requirements, MLT License required.
  • National Certification (ASCP or ASCLS) preferred.
  • 0 – 1 year related experience with college degree and license plus certification or 3 – 5 years' experience with no license or certification.
  • Basic knowledge of medical laboratory testing and experience in clinical laboratory required.
  • Good verbal communication skills.
  • Must be able to multi-task, prioritize and manage time efficiently.
  • Prior experience with laboratory systems preferred.
  • PC literacy required.
  • Ability to follow precise directions in a situation requiring speed, accuracy, and efficiency.
